HASL or HAL (for hot air (solder) leveling) is a type of finish used on printed circuit boards (PCBs). The PCB is typically dipped into a bath of molten solder so that all exposed copper surfaces are covered by solder.

Lead-free HASL uses lead-free alloys and offers a smooth, even, and high-quality surface finish. This finish is highly solderable and environment-friendly. Coating thickness is more uniform and thus eliminates coplanarity issues caused by the HASL process (on BGA , CSP pads, etc.).

Aug 29, 2023 · Traditional HASL uses a tin-lead solder alloy containing about 63% tin and 37% lead. Lead-free HASL substitutes lead for metals like silver, copper, bismuth, or antimony while maintaining a high tin content above 95%.
